如何在linux中启动tomcat服务器?

19 linux installation tomcat centos startup

我试着安装

   1.yum install -zxvf apache-tomcat-6.0.47.tar.gz then 
   2.  export TOMCAT_HOME=/home/mpatil/softwares/apache-tomcat-6.0.37
   3. [root@localhost mpatil]# echo $TOMCAT_HOME 
      /home/mpatil/softwares/apache-tomcat-7.0.47
Run Code Online (Sandbox Code Playgroud)

使用此命令启动tomcat

   4.[root@localhost mpatil]# /startup.sh 
bash: /startup.sh: No such file or directory 
Run Code Online (Sandbox Code Playgroud)

我不知道为什么会这样.

我的档案

      5.[root@localhost mpatil]#  find /home -type f -name   apache-tomcat-6.0.37.tar.gz
/home/mpatil/Downloads/apache-tomcat-6.0.37.tar.gz
Run Code Online (Sandbox Code Playgroud)

我之前尝试过的是正确与否? - 请告诉我我的问题是如何在linux中启动一个tomcat服务器.请告诉我..

小智 38

您键入的命令是/startup.sh,如果您必须启动shell脚本,则必须触发命令,如下所示:

$ cd /home/mpatil/softwares/apache-tomcat-7.0.47/bin
$ sh startup.sh 
or 
$ ./startup.sh 
Run Code Online (Sandbox Code Playgroud)

请尝试一下,您还必须转到tomcat的bin文件夹(使用cd-command)来执行此shell脚本.在你的情况下,这是/home/mpatil/softwares/apache-tomcat-7.0.47/bin.


Oma*_*nik 5

if you are a sudo user i mean if you got sudo access:

      sudo sh startup.sh 
Run Code Online (Sandbox Code Playgroud)

otherwise: sh startup.sh

But things is that you have to be on the bin directory of your server like

cd /home/nanofaroque/servers/apache-tomcat-7.0.47/bin


小智 5

使用./catalina.sh start启动Tomcat。做得到./catalina.sh用法。

我正在使用apache-tomcat-6.0.36。